Infrastructure Focus Group

The CIO Network is proud to launch the Infrastructure Focus Group enabling Infrastructure teams from larger organisation's in Australia to share best practice and leverage peer experience to address common challenges.

Membership to the Infrastructure Focus Group is for a team within the organisation or business unit, depending on the size/structure of the organisation. Organisations with several business units like banks would need separate memberships for each business unit if each business has their own Infrastructure group. Infrastructure Focus Group members will have access to Infrastructure discussion groups only and no other CIO Network focus groups discussions.

Members of the Infrastructure Focus Group will be entitled to monthly discussion group on infrastructure related topics nominated by infrastructure executives, practical library of notes created from all our discussion groups, 1-1 engagements with peer companies via teleconference or face to face, mentoring service to enable executive development and access to discounted industry events to name a few.

To enable organisations to trial our services, we are offering Infrastructure executives the option to attend a discussion group as a non-member so as to help make the decision to join the focus group as a member easier.
